The Wisconsin Department of Natural Resources has issued an Air Quality Advisory for the following counties: Columbia, Dane, Dodge, Fond du Lac, Green, Green Lake, Jefferson, Kenosha, Marquette, Milwaukee, Ozaukee, Racine, Rock, Sheboygan, Walworth, Washington, Waukesha.
WHAT,The PM2.5 AQI is expected to reach the Unhealthy for Sensitive Groups level.
WHERE,Southeast and northeast Wisconsin, including portions of south-central and central Wisconsin.
WHEN,Until 6 p.m.
Precautionary/Preparedness Actions: Sensitive groups: Make outdoor activities shorter and less intense. It is OK to be active outdoors but take more breaks. Watch for symptoms such as coughing or shortness of breath. People with asthma: Follow your asthma action plan and keep quick relief medicine handy. People with heart disease: Symptoms such as palpitations, shortness of breath, or unusual fatigue may indicate a serious problem. If you have any of these, contact your health care provider.
Additional Details: Smoke is clearing from NW to SE but it will take longer to clear across the eastern half of the state. Continual clearing of the smoke as well as storm activity should diminish advisory level smoke by 6 p.m.
